NBA Finals Game 4 Preview

Dammit Rondo, learn how to shoot.
The Lakers are looking to tie up the series tonight at 2 games a piece and rebound from the 2 game deficit that they were in. If the Lakers win tonight, I see them going back to Boston with a 3-2 series lead. HOWEVAH, the Celtics are going to win tonight. First of all, Paul Pierce is not going to have another 2-14 shooting performance and Kevin Garnett is probably going to be bad offensively again because you can never trust him in the clutch, but expect him to play great defense and get tough rebounds. And expect Pierce to go for about 30 points tonight. Also, Sasha Vujacic is not going to shoot lights out again because I don't think he has had two good games back to back this entire season. I don't know if that previous sentence is true, but I'm gonna take a page out of KillaFam's playbook and say that it is. Anyways, I think a Celtics victory is also pretty dependent on the health of Rajon Rondo. He needs to play well for the Celtics to have any kind of offensive fluidity. He was a tremendous catalyst in game 2 when he dished out 16 assists, and only shot the ball 4 times. That's what he needs to do in this game because let's face it, Rondo shoots like a poor man's Jason McElwain. So, expect a win by the Boston Celtics tonight if Rondo is his usual self.
Prediciton: Celtics 90, Lakers 86
